Puçol Municipal Market is a local food market located in the centre of Puçol, Valencia province. The market operates three days per week, opening on Wednesday, Friday and Saturday from 9 AM to 2 PM. Vendors offer fresh local produce and quality food products. This municipal market serves the local community with essential groceries and fresh ingredients.

About Puçol Municipal Market
The market provides a traditional shopping experience where local residents purchase their weekly groceries and fresh ingredients.
The indoor municipal building houses various food stalls specialising in different products. Visitors will find the market atmosphere relaxed and community-focused, with vendors who know their regular customers personally.
The market accepts modern payment methods including mobile and contactless payments, making transactions convenient for all shoppers. The building features wheelchair accessible entrances, ensuring all community members can access the facilities.
Best visited during morning hours when the selection is at its peak, the market offers an efficient shopping experience within its compact layout. The location in central Puçol makes it easily accessible for both local residents and visitors exploring the town's commercial area.

Get DirectionsHow to Get There
The market is located on Carrer de Marià Amigó in central Puçol, easily accessible on foot from the town centre.
Puçol can be reached by Cercanías train from Valencia, with the train station located within walking distance of the market. Local bus services also connect Puçol with surrounding areas.
For those driving, street parking is typically available in the surrounding residential streets.
